Clark Ready For Battle With Marshall

14.01 - Lake George, NY - www.TheDailySports.com, Inc. announced the Main Event for the "YOUNG GUNS" At The Friar Tuck Inn professional boxing show scheduled for Friday, January 24, 2003 at the Friar Tuck Inn, in Catskill, New York.

The Main Event will feature Former NABF Jr. Welterweight Champion and current Jr. Middleweight contender, Tony Marshall, 35-10-6 (12 KOs) as he takes on the tough Charles Clark, 14-12-1 (5 KOs) in an eight round Jr. Middleweight bout.

Marshall is coming off a ten-round decision victory over Benji Singleton in October to notch his 35th career win. Prior to that, Tony hadn't fought since his loss to Ouma Kassin in June of 2001.

"I can't wait to fight before a "Home Town" crowd. The last time I fought here, I packed the Pepsi Arena", said Marshall. He added, "It will be like fighting before all my friends and family. I am really looking forward to it!"

Clark is not to be taken lightly. Clark's last two fights were in July 2002. He won a majority decision over Gerald Reed on July 2nd, and then lost a decision to the highly regarded, Peter Manfredo Jr. in his hometown in Rhode Island on July 26th.

"Clark is ready for this fight. He has been training hard and has something to prove. This fight is going to be a real war", said Clark's Trainer, Bobby Glassmeyer.

Catskill Resident and former Mike Tyson Trainer, Kevin Rooney will be showcasing his newest Heavyweight sensation, Thomas Hayes, 2-0 (2 KOs) when he takes on Mike Darrell, 0-1 is a special 4-round bout.
